What Makes a B550 Motherboard a Good Choice for Budget Builds?

A B550 motherboard is an excellent choice for budget builds due to its balance of features, performance, and cost-effectiveness.

  • PCIe 4.0 Support: The B550 motherboards offer PCIe 4.0 support for the graphics card and M.2 storage, allowing for faster data transfer rates and improved performance with compatible devices.
  • Affordable Pricing: Compared to higher-end motherboards, B550 options are generally more budget-friendly while still providing essential features that cater to gamers and casual users alike.
  • Future-Proofing: With support for the latest AMD Ryzen processors and the AM4 socket, B550 motherboards allow users to upgrade their CPU without needing to replace the motherboard, making it a long-term investment.
  • Decent VRM and Cooling: Many B550 motherboards come equipped with robust voltage regulator modules (VRMs) and adequate cooling solutions, ensuring stable power delivery and thermal performance for overclocking or high-performance tasks.
  • Comprehensive Connectivity Options: These motherboards typically feature a variety of ports, including USB 3.2 Gen 2, Wi-Fi 6, and multiple display outputs, catering to diverse connectivity needs without the need for additional expansion cards.
  • Good RAM Support: B550 motherboards usually support dual-channel DDR4 RAM with higher speeds, which can significantly enhance system performance and efficiency, particularly in gaming and multitasking scenarios.

Why is VRM Quality Critical for Stability in Budget B550 Motherboards?

The quality of the Voltage Regulator Modules (VRMs) is crucial for stable performance in budget B550 motherboards. VRMs are responsible for converting the 12V power supply from the PSU to the lower voltages required by the CPU and other components. Inexpensive motherboards often compromise on VRM design, leading to inadequate power delivery. This can result in:

  • Overheating: Poor VRM quality may not dissipate heat effectively, causing thermal throttling and limiting CPU performance.
  • Power Delivery Issues: If a motherboard has insufficient VRM phases, it might struggle to supply stable power, especially during high loads or overclocking.
  • System Stability: Inconsistent power can lead to system crashes, especially in critical gaming or productivity scenarios.

Selecting a budget B550 motherboard with robust VRMs ensures better voltage regulation and efficiency. Features to look for include:

  • More Phases: A higher number of phases can distribute power evenly and reduce strain on individual components.
  • Heatsinks: Effective cooling solutions on the VRMs help maintain optimal temperatures during demanding tasks.

Investing in a motherboard with quality VRMs enhances overall system reliability and performance, which is particularly vital for budget builds aiming for longevity and stability.

What Connectivity Options Should You Prioritize for a Budget B550 Motherboard?

When selecting a budget B550 motherboard, it’s essential to prioritize certain connectivity options to ensure optimal performance and expandability.

  • PCIe 4.0 Support: Look for motherboards that offer PCIe 4.0 slots, as they provide higher bandwidth for graphics cards and NVMe SSDs compared to the previous generation. This feature is particularly useful for gamers and content creators who need faster data transfer speeds and improved graphics performance.
  • USB Type-C Port: A USB Type-C port adds versatility for connecting modern peripherals and devices, allowing for faster data transfer and charging capabilities. It’s becoming increasingly common in many devices, making it a valuable feature for future-proofing your setup.
  • M.2 Slots for NVMe SSDs: Ensure that the motherboard has multiple M.2 slots to accommodate NVMe SSDs, which offer superior speed and performance over traditional SATA drives. Having more M.2 slots allows for easier upgrades and better storage management.
  • Wi-Fi and Bluetooth Support: Integrated Wi-Fi and Bluetooth can save you the cost of purchasing separate adapters, making your build more streamlined. This is especially important for users in environments where wired connections are not feasible.
  • Multiple USB Ports: Check for a good number of USB ports, including USB 3.2 Gen 2, which offers faster data transfer speeds. A variety of ports ensures that you can connect all your peripherals without requiring additional hubs.
  • Audio and Ethernet Quality: Pay attention to the quality of the onboard audio chipset and Ethernet controller; good audio can enhance your gaming and media experience, while a reliable Ethernet connection is crucial for online gaming and streaming. Look for motherboards with high-quality audio capacitors and at least a Gigabit Ethernet connection for optimal performance.
